What is Microblading?

Microblading is a cosmetic tattoo procedure that fills in thin eyebrows to make them fuller and darker. It is a semi-permanent method and its results can last for up to 3 years. Microblading is usually done using a pen-like handheld tool with needles fitted at the end.

The initial process will take about a couple of hours. You can start seeing the results immediately. However, you’ll need to go for 1 more sitting to get the perfect eyebrows and retouch the color.

One thing you ought to be careful about is the expertise of the person microblading your eyebrows. It is not without risks and can lead to infections if the tools, needles, or colors used are not of high quality.

Difference between Microblading and Permanent Tattoo

The first difference between the two is that a tattoo is permanent. The results of microblading last for around 2-3 years at the most.

The ink in microblading just goes 1 layer into your skin whereas in a permanent tattoo the ink goes 5-6 layers deeper which is why it is a more permanent procedure.

The colors in microblading do not change. They do lighten but don’t turn into another color. For example, your black eyebrows will not become brown after a few months.

Permanent tattoo looks more artificial, whereas microblading draws hair like strokes to give it a more natural effect.

The primary difference between microblading and permanent tattoos is that microbladed eyebrows are drawn using the hand. The amount of pressure is less in microblading and thus, prevents bleeding of color over time.

Tools Used in Microblading

Microblading is a skill that needs practice and the right equipment. Every microblading expert needs to have the following tools in their kit.

  • Blades and Needles

During the shaping procedure the artist will use a blade to remove the extras and give you the perfect shape. The microblading tool is a pen-like instrument with a super-fine tip at one end. This tip uses needles to make a slight cut in the skin and fill the pigment in the upper layer. These create a hair-like effect in the brows to make your eyebrows look naturally full.

  • Pigments

Pigments are different from the ink used in the permanent tattoo. The pigments are available in several colors, ranging from white to shades of brown and black. The expert will use and mix different colors to make your eyebrows look natural and real.

  • Anesthetics & Healing Serums

Microblading involves making a cut on the skin. Without safety precautions, it could lead to infections and cause skin damage. It involves numbing the brow area to reduce pain during the procedure & applying antiseptic serums after the process is mandatory.

  • Accessories

It’s necessary to draw precise lines before filling in the brows. The shape of the eyebrows changes the entire appearance of your face. Microblading experts use rulers and measuring tools to mark the eyebrows and shape them. Correction sticks and saline paste are used to fix tiny mistakes that might happen during the procedure.

Types of Needles Used in Microblading for Different Looks

The microblading procedure might be the same, but it doesn’t mean that the experts use the same blades and needles for every person. The type of needle changes based on the shape of the brows you want & your skin type. Let’s look at the needles available in the market.

Curved Flat or Round Flat Blade

These needles do the majority of the work in microblading. Each needle is called a pin. You can get blades with a varying number of pins. Experts will determine this based on the length of the stroke for hair-like effect in the brow.

Every pin/ needle in this blade touches the skin at the same time. The curved shape helps in giving your brows a natural look. Beginners use the soft version of the blade as it’s easier to handle.

U-Shaped

This blade has a shape like the letter U, with needles on both ends shorter in size than in the middle. The blades come in different sizes, depending on how thick the brows should be.

The U blade helps to fill the area near the nose. The strokes are called blub strokes. Experienced artists use these as it’s easy to make a mistake if one is not careful.

Flat Shader

As the name suggests, the flat shader has needles of the same size and length. It is used for outlining and to fill in the narrow parts for the eyebrow. The shaders come in a single and double row of needles and are great to create the ombre effect.

Round Shader

Needles of the same length are bundled together. This shader is used to fill and increase the density of color. It also makes it easy to fill the brows faster and get better coverage. The round shader also comes in different sizes. The one with fewer pins is used for thinner brows and vice versa.

Flexible/ Soft and Hard Bases

The needles are fixed in a base that can either be soft or hard. Since microblading involves breaking the skin to penetrate the epidermis layer, you must choose the instrument carefully. Why?

The first reason is that each skin has a different thickness. Some people naturally have thinner skin. Age is another factor. As you age, your skin loses its elasticity and becomes leaner.

The skills and expertise of the microblading expert also need to be considered. The flexible base is made of plastic. The base bends and prevents the cuts from getting too deep or excess pigment from being deposited.

The hard base made of aluminum is the opposite of flexible bases. These are more suited for people with oily and thicker skin. The hard base is perfect for detailing as well. That said, every microblading artist should have both hard and soft bases in their kit.

Blade Length

A smaller blade is used for minute details, and the larger ones are suited for brush strokes. Each blade comes with a different number of pins –

  • 7-9 pins for short fine strokes and touchups
  • 10-13 pins for medium-length strokes and used for every person
  • 14-17 pins for outlining, filling, and longer hair strokes
  • 18-21 pins for the longest strokes and used only by experts

Nano Blades

Nano blades are used for machine microblading to create tiny brow hair that you cannot make manually. These come in different blade lengths and shapes.

Double Row

As mentioned above, shaders can have single or double rows. The double row shaders help to get a uniform effect & in structuring the brow.
